West Denver, Denver, CO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in West Denver?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
West Denver Studio Apartments | $1,680 | $525 | $5,613 |
West Denver 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,105 | $522 | $7,229 |
West Denver 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,843 | $600 | $10,000+ |
West Denver 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,192 | $880 | $10,000+ |
West Denver 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,556 | $950 | $4,888 |

Quick Rent Budget Calculator
How much rent can you afford?
The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.
